Eclipse Mylyn成为顶级项目
http://www.infoq.com/cn/news/2010/09/eclipse-mylyn/?作為應用程序的生命周期管理工具,Eclipse Mylyn項目已經被提升為頂級的Eclipse項目(但是還保留Mylyn作為它的簡稱)。它的項目章程說明了它在生態系統中的目的。
這對一般的Eclipse Mylyn用戶來說,(直接的)意義沒有什么不同。Mylyn會繼續由原來的項目執行者來開發,并且提供與當前使用的相同類型的體驗:專注于開發者。成為Eclipse的頂級項目也表示當前它的項目結構已經過時,Eclipse當前項目的組織有兩種級別的執行結構,一種是Eclipse項目,像JDT和PDE,另一種是工具項目,像CDT和PDT。
為了找到項目所處的位置,Mylyn花費了不少時間,它已經度過了孵化器,經過了技術項目階段,然后是工具項目階段,直到最終成為頂級項目。 項目的主體已經不在技術或者工具項目中了,而對其性質的選擇很隨意,并且在很多情況下對于用戶和項目執行者都是不可見的)。切分主要是基于CVS或者SVN根目錄的,這會導致一場討論:項目是要遷移到Git,還是擺脫執行庫結構(enforced repository structure)的束縛。
作為重新組織工作的一部分,Mylyn正在創建屬于自己的一些二級項目。這事實上只是對現存的Mylyn模塊進行重新分塊,其中EGit和CVS連接器成為Mylyn/SCM項目的一部分,Bugzilla和Trac連接器成為Mylyn/Tasks項目和Mylyn/Context項目的一部分,這構成了活動的UI過濾機制的基礎,它會讓Mylyn重新流行起來。
然而,Mylyn多年來并沒有保持穩定,并且越來越多樣化。Mylyn的WikiText組件最初用來是以友好的方式編寫bug報告的,而現在已經作為副產品成為單獨的Mylyn/Docs項目,其中還加入了基于富文本的編輯功能。類似地,Mylyn進行了擴展,并與Hudson整合,這包含了讀取控制臺輸出的能力,并能夠嵌入到服務器上失敗的測試中,就像處理本地測試失敗情況一樣容易。
最后,Mylyn為自己設定了一個目標,它要向基于代碼審查的系統提供界面,最初的計劃是要提供簡單的基于任務的Mylyn審查系統,并且會嵌入到現存的代碼審查系統中。
想要了解更多信息,請查看對Mik Kersten的訪談以及項目章程。
轉載于:https://www.cnblogs.com/svennee/p/4079106.html
總結
以上是生活随笔為你收集整理的Eclipse Mylyn成为顶级项目的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: [Python]ConfigParser
- 下一篇: 运行时类信息机制